1. What Is MyTHDHR?
MyTHDHR is Home Depot’s centralized online platform for human resources and workforce management. It allows associates to access important information, update personal details, and make use of resources without having to go through traditional HR channels.
2. Key Functions of MyTHDHR
The platform covers a wide spectrum of employee needs, including:
- Pay and Tax Information – Review earnings, download pay stubs, and access tax forms.
- Benefits Enrollment – Select and adjust healthcare plans, retirement contributions, and insurance options.
- Scheduling Tools – Stay updated with work shifts and upcoming schedules.
- Direct Deposit – Add or change bank account details for salary deposits.
- Career Growth Resources – Access training programs and internal job postings.
